Police arrested a man, woman and two teens for allegedly forcing their way into a home and holding a man at gunpoint.
Police responded to a call at a home near east Admiral and south Pittsburg early Monday morning. They say Priscilla and Matthew Sandoval and two teens forced their way into the home, pointed a gun at a man inside and robbed him.
Police say the four of them led police on a short chase before they crashed the car near 26th and north Yale. All four face charges including 1st degree burglary.
